Laurinaitis switches to Ohio State

Plymouth (Minn.) Wayzata linebacker James Laurinaitis not only made an official visit to Ohio State, he has switched his commitment from Minnesota to the Buckeyes.
"I had a great time," Laurinaitis said of his trip to Columbus. "I committed to Ohio State.

"I really liked things. I really liked the coaches."
The 6-foot-2 and 230 pound Laurinaitis is the No. 28 inside linebacker prospect in the Rivals.com player rankings and the No. 5 prospect in the state of Minnesota.
Laurinaitis made 193 tackles including 28 behind the line of scrimmage during his senior season. He had five sacks and seven quarterback pressures.
Wayzata coach Brad Anderson is certainly high on his star player.
"He is a very fast and active linebacker," Anderson said. "He makes plays from sideline to sideline. And he's a natural leader."
